First, let me state that I’m not a big fan of coffee stout. This one has a very subtle coffee aroma that is dominated by a slightly smokey tobacco and licorice roastiness that is slightly acrid. Taste is mostly roasted bitterness with some supporting malt sweetness. Round and medium full body. Very aggressive bitterness that finishes harsh and course, which brings down the score a lot. Could do a lot better with a more noble hop bitterness. duff (5475), Surrey, Greater London, England

Aroma of roast, coffee and cocoa. Full and rich. Flavour is roasted, coffeeish, has cocoanotes and is quite burnt. Full bodied. Very smooth and balanced brew. Ends on a quite roasty coffeenote with quite some bitterness. Is rather dry. Papsoe (14996), Frederiksberg, Denmark
